资料介绍
基于AT89S52单片机的温湿度检测仪
摘 要
随着社会的发展,人们对环境中的温度和湿度的要求也越来越高,尤其是在医学、电子电力、航天航空、食品发酵等领域中对温湿度的要求尤其严格,鉴于如此设计出一个能够精确、稳定、实时测量出环境中温湿度的实用型温湿度检测仪显得尤为重要。
本温湿度检测仪是以AT89S52单片机的为核心控制芯片,该单片机有很好的抗干扰能力、响应速度快。基于此单片机的温湿度检测仪可以实时、准确的测量环境中的温度和相对湿度。
本检测仪的硬件部分的设计采用了0809A/D转换器以高灵敏度采集湿敏电阻阻值变化,在经过单片机处理得到相应湿度; 单片机直接控制温度传感器DS18B20对温度实时采集和监控。本仪器还增加了报警装置,用户可根据需要设定温湿度上下限,若当前温湿度超限便会报警。接入独立键盘键盘实现人机交换功能,并用LCD12864作为显示设备的硬件设计方案。软件部分则采用模块化的方法将其分成几个部分,然后逐模块设计程序,用C语言来实现,使各部分结合起来协调工作,最终实现对环境中温湿度的实时检测。
该温湿度检测仪能够基本完成的温湿度检测,但由于个人经验不足等因素,本设
计还有一些不足之处,离产品实用还有一定的差距,还有一些方面需要进一步完善。
关键词:AT89S52单片机,A/D转换器,传感器,LCD,温湿度
第1章 温湿度检测仪总体技术方案
温湿度作为环境中的两项重要参数,在很多方面都起着重要的作用。本文中的基于AT89S52单片机的湿度检测仪就是针对这一需求而设计的。它综合运用了现代检测技术、数据处理和通信技术以及LCD显示技术,可以实时、准确、稳定的测量环境中的温度和相对湿度。在此设计过程中,本设计综合分析了不同用户在不同场合的不同需求,经研究之后,采用了AT89S52单片机为核心控制器件,A/D0809转换器以高灵敏度温度传感器和湿度传感器为数据获取元件的方案。该设计主要分为硬件设计和软件部分的设计,下面先总体介绍设计的性能指标和软硬件的总体设计方案。
§1.1 温湿度检测仪的主要性能指标及其工作原理
§1.1.1 性能指标
1. 相对湿度测量精度和范围: ±5%,检测范围0~100%;
2. 温度测量精度: ±1℃,检测范围0~100℃;
3. 温湿度上下限设定范围:20~100,0~20;
4. LCD实时显示;
6. 工作环境温度≤90℃ ,工作环境湿度≤90%;
§1.1.2 温湿度检测仪的工作原理
加载有相应程序的AT89S52单片机定时采集温度传感器信号和相对湿度测量电路电压输出信号此电压由两位数码管显示出来,从而获得温度和相对湿度数据,分别将这些数据存储于数据存储器中,用户可根据需要设定温湿度上下限值,若单片机采集的数据超限便会报警。温湿度上下限显示和当前显示都由LCD12864显示屏显示,可通过键盘电路来选择检测湿度或者检测温度。
§1.2 温湿度检测仪的硬件设计总体结构方案
该检测仪采用AT89S52单片机为核心,整个硬件系统分为以下几个部件,具体如图1-1所示:
- (毕业设计资料)基于单片机温湿度PM2.5报警设置系统
- 基于单片机GSM光照温湿度检测系统设计(毕业设计资料)
- 基于单片机温湿度红外无线传输设计(毕业设计资料)
- 单片机课程设计——基于51单片机温湿度检测系统的设计与实现
- 【毕设狗】【单片机毕业设计】基于单片机的温湿度检测及控制的设计(实物+proteus仿真+源码+原理图+软件设计
- 基于单片机温湿度光照自动窗帘系统设计(毕业设计资料)
- 基于单片机环境监测温湿度PM2.5系统设计(毕业设计资料)
- AT89S52单片机思维导图
- 20-基于51单片机的温湿度检测仪设计
- 20-基于51单片机温湿度检测仪设计
- STC89C52RC单片机或AT89S52单片机串口发送温湿度数据的程序免费下载
- 基于AT89S52单片机的蔬菜大棚温湿度检测装置的设计 40次下载
- 单片机AT89S52介绍 93次下载
- 毕业设计-基于AT89S52单片机的电子万年历设计 84次下载
- 单片机AT89S52实用教程 794次下载
- 基于STM32单片机的粮仓温湿度控制系统设计 499次阅读
- 基于STM32单片机的疫苗冷链加温湿度系统设计 700次阅读
- 基于单片机和LabVIEW的温湿度监测系统设计 5337次阅读
- 基于51单片机的温湿度检测报警系统设计 5683次阅读
- 基于8051单片机的温湿度采集系统设计 1711次阅读
- 基于AT89S52单片机和GPS OEM 板实现GPS授时服务器的设计 4428次阅读
- 基于AT89S52单片机和LTM8901实现智能环境温湿度控制系统的设计 1247次阅读
- 使用51单片机实现SHT11温湿度传感器检测的程序和电路图 1.7w次阅读
- 基于AT89S52单片机的温度和湿度检测系统设计 2989次阅读
- AT89S52单片机对太阳能发电系统参数测试仪的设计 1046次阅读
- 单片机at89s52和其他单片机比有什么优劣势 5.3w次阅读
- 利用AT89S52型单片机智能电子称系统设计 6512次阅读
- adc0832与at89s52接口电路及真空度数据采集 8772次阅读
- 基于单片机的温湿度实时监控的程序设计 3091次阅读
- at89s52最小系统图 单片机最小系统介绍与设计 3.2w次阅读
下载排行
本周
- 1TC358743XBG评估板参考手册
- 1.36 MB | 330次下载 | 免费
- 2开关电源基础知识
- 5.73 MB | 6次下载 | 免费
- 3100W短波放大电路图
- 0.05 MB | 4次下载 | 3 积分
- 4嵌入式linux-聊天程序设计
- 0.60 MB | 3次下载 | 免费
- 5基于FPGA的光纤通信系统的设计与实现
- 0.61 MB | 2次下载 | 免费
- 6基于FPGA的C8051F单片机开发板设计
- 0.70 MB | 2次下载 | 免费
- 751单片机窗帘控制器仿真程序
- 1.93 MB | 2次下载 | 免费
- 8基于51单片机的RGB调色灯程序仿真
- 0.86 MB | 2次下载 | 免费
本月
- 1OrCAD10.5下载OrCAD10.5中文版软件
- 0.00 MB | 234315次下载 | 免费
- 2555集成电路应用800例(新编版)
- 0.00 MB | 33564次下载 | 免费
- 3接口电路图大全
- 未知 | 30323次下载 | 免费
- 4开关电源设计实例指南
- 未知 | 21548次下载 | 免费
- 5电气工程师手册免费下载(新编第二版pdf电子书)
- 0.00 MB | 15349次下载 | 免费
- 6数字电路基础pdf(下载)
- 未知 | 13750次下载 | 免费
- 7电子制作实例集锦 下载
- 未知 | 8113次下载 | 免费
- 8《LED驱动电路设计》 温德尔著
- 0.00 MB | 6653次下载 | 免费
总榜
- 1matlab软件下载入口
- 未知 | 935054次下载 | 免费
- 2protel99se软件下载(可英文版转中文版)
- 78.1 MB | 537796次下载 | 免费
- 3MATLAB 7.1 下载 (含软件介绍)
- 未知 | 420026次下载 | 免费
- 4OrCAD10.5下载OrCAD10.5中文版软件
- 0.00 MB | 234315次下载 | 免费
- 5Altium DXP2002下载入口
- 未知 | 233046次下载 | 免费
- 6电路仿真软件multisim 10.0免费下载
- 340992 | 191185次下载 | 免费
- 7十天学会AVR单片机与C语言视频教程 下载
- 158M | 183278次下载 | 免费
- 8proe5.0野火版下载(中文版免费下载)
- 未知 | 138040次下载 | 免费
评论
查看更多